Curriculum of Slavic Studies

Marta Belia graduated in Intercultural and Linguistic Mediation at Sapienza University of Rome in 2017 with a thesis on Czech literature entitled „Reflection on writing in the texts of Bohumil Hrabal“ followed by Prof. Annalisa Cosentino. In January 2020 she graduated in Linguistics, Literary and Translation Studies at Sapienza University of Rome with a thesis on Czech poetry of the twentieth century entitled „Being a poet: Jaroslav Seifert and Jan Skácel witnesses of the twentieth century“ (Supervisor: Prof. Annalisa Cosentino, Assistant supervisor: Prof. Emanuela Sgambati). Thanks to the Erasmus program, in 2018 she spent a semester at Charles University in Prague attending Czech language and contemporary Czech literature courses.

Currently she deals with contemporary Czech poetry, in particular in the context of the PhD, her research focuses on the theme of everyday life in the works of Czech poets who have marked the twentieth century and contemporaneity.
